What is Hydroponic Gardening?

Hydroponics is an approach where plants grow in a nutrient-rich water service as opposed to traditional soil. It uses a number of advantages like faster development, greater returns, and also specific control over environmental problems.

Starting

1. Choose Your Growing Hydroponic System:
There are numerous hydroponic systems to select from:

  • Deep Water Culture (DWC): Plants are suspended in nutrient-rich water with their origins submerged, and also an air pump maintains the water oxygenated.
  • Nutrient Movie Method (NFT): This approach makes use of a slim movie of nutrient remedy that moves over the plant roots continuously.
  • Drip Systems: Nutrient service is delivered to the origins with tubes as well as emitters, using customization alternatives.
  • Wick Systems: These systems use a wick to transport nutrition service to the origin zone, making them terrific for small-scale setups.
2. Gather Your Materials:
Below's what you'll need:

  • Containers or trays for your plants
  • Growing medium (like rockwool, perlite, or coconut coir).
  • Nutrient solution.
  • pH and EC (electric conductivity) meters.
  • pH adjusters.
  • Lighting (commonly LED or fluorescent grow lights).
  • Air pump and also air stones (for DWC systems).
  • Timers as well as controllers (for automation).
3. Setting Up Your Hydroponic Garden:

  • Discover an ideal area with great ventilation for your hydroponic garden.
  • Fill your containers with your selected expanding tool.
  • Set up your picked hydroponic system, linking the required elements.
  • Mix the nutrient solution according to the producer's guidelines.
  • Change the pH as well as EC of the nutrient service to the optimal levels for your plants (typically pH 5.5-6.5 as well as EC 1.2-2.2 for a lot of plants).
  • Mount your illumination system, ensuring it provides ample protection and also strength.
  • Start with healthy seedlings or duplicates as well as transplant them right into your hydroponic system.
Keeping Your Hydroponic Garden.

When your hydroponic garden is established, maintenance is fairly simple:

  • Consistently inspect and also change the pH as well as EC degrees of the nutrient remedy.
  • Display the water level in the tank and also top it up as required.
  • Change the nutrient service every 1-2 weeks to prevent discrepancies.
  • Guarantee your plants get adequate light and also change the range in between the lights and also the plants.
  • Look out for parasites as well as conditions as well as take preventive measures to keep them away.
  • Prune as well as train your plants as they expand to maintain an also cover.
  • Collect your plants when they reach peak ripeness, which is usually quicker than traditional horticulture.
